City Guide
Pontotoc, Mississippi, United States
Overview
Pontotoc is a friendly, small city in northern Mississippi known for its historical roots and welcoming community spirit. With a charming downtown square and easy access to natural beauty, Pontotoc offers visitors a quintessential Southern small-town experience.
Best Time to Visit
March-May & September-November for mild weather and local festivals.
Local Tips
Most restaurants and shops close by early evening; having a car is helpful for getting around. Check the local calendar for seasonal events or markets.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ping 15–20% is customary in restaurants. Dress is generally casual, but modest in religious or rural settings. A friendly greeting is always appreciated.
Safety Warnings
Pontotoc is generally safe, but stay aware in less populated areas at night and be cautious when driving after dark due to local wildlife.
Hidden Gems
Check out the Pontotoc County Historical Museum, the Tanglefoot Trail for biking and walking, and small bakeries around the square for local treats.
